Tasting from 19.03.2021: Othmar Kiem, Simon Staffler

Rich, flint ruby. Open nose with lots of ripe fruit, plums, mulberry and liquorice. Much ripe, dense tannin on the palate, firm and full-bodied, cherry and bitter chocolate on the finish.
